Koko and Camaro are Salt Lake City musicians Greg Midgley and Scott Harker. Their sound is something that they describe as “Howling Wolf meets the RZA.” We didn’t quite know what to expect when they came into the studio this past Wednesday, and they didn’t either. But the results are undeniable. This was one of our favorite sessions to date. Enjoy.

Morgan Snow is a local singer songwriter living in Salt Lake City. You will hear elements of folk, rock, and country in his music. Morgan’s strong voice and his gritty stripped down songwriting style reflects his personal observations of the dark corners in life and the well-lit conversations along the way. Look for this artist playing locally as either a solo act, or with his full band, Triggers and Slips.
